Use of Card. Credit for purchases from a merchant or a cash advance from a participating financial institution may be obtained by Holder or an authorized user of Holder’s card presenting one of Holder’s cards to the merchant or participating financial institution and , if requested by providing the proper identifying information and signing the appropriate drafts. Failure to sign a draft does not relieve the Holder of liability for purchases made or cash received. The use of this card for illegal transactions is prohibited. The card may also be used to obtain cash advances from certain automated equipment provided it is used with Holder’s correct Personal Identification Number (“PIN”) issued to Holder. Holder may perform cash advance withdrawals totaling not more than $500 each day from compatible ATM terminals. Terminals or terminal operators may have other limits on the amounts or frequency of cash withdrawals. Holder will not be liable for the unauthorized use of the card or PIN issued to Holder which occurs before Issuer receives notification orally or in writing of loss, theft or possible unauthorized use of card or PIN. Use of Card. 4.1 The Card Holder shall be required to treat their Card, PIN Code, and Platform Access Code and Password with due care. The Card Holder shall be required to take any action that is required to secure their Card and to prevent its unauthorised use. 4.2 A Card Holder shall be required to arrange for a Card to be blocked immediately if there is any reason to do so. In this respect the Card Holder shall always be required to ensure that they are familiar with any directions which XXImo issues, for example, to prevent their Card and PIN Code from being used for fraudulent purposes. 4.3 The Card Holder shall always have a duty to store their Card safely and with due care. In this respect the Card Holder shall ensure that: a. no other person can see their Card in the place where it is stored when the Card Holder is not using it; b. no other person can see where the Card Holder keeps their Card; c. their Card is stored in such a way that it is impossible for any other person to take the Card without being noticed; d. they do not lose their Card. For the purposes of Subclauses (a) to (c) "other person" is deemed to refer to: a family member, a friend, a housemate, colleague, member of a Partner's staff or any of the Card Holder's visitors. 4.4 The Card Holder shall always be required to exercise due care when using their Card. The following rules shall at any rate apply in this respect: a. the Card Holder shall never relinquish possession of their Card, even if another person wishes to help them; b. the Card Holder shall never lose sight of their Card until it is safely stored again; c. the Card Holder shall always check that their own Card is returned to them after it has been used and that it is not switched for another one; d. the Card Holder shall strictly heed any directions on an automatic telling machine or point- of-sale terminal concerning its security. e. the Card Holder shall contact XXImo immediately through the alarm centre specified by XXImo to arrange for their Card to be blocked or if it is not returned to them following a transaction; f. the Card Holder shall not use their Card where they know or suspect that its use in certain situations is or may be insecure; g. the Card Holder shall not allow themself to be distracted when they use their Card.
